Who we’re looking for

Toyota’s Retail Market Development (RMD) Department is looking for a passionate and highly motivated Business Management Analyst. 

  

RMD is responsible for providing information, guidance, and insight to the field offices and TMNA regarding all facets of the Dealer Life Cycle to ensure that we have the Best Dealers in the Best Locations with the Best Facilities and the Best Performance. Business Management is one of five groups within RMD and is responsible for the collection and review of the Toyota and Lexus dealer financial statements. 

Reporting to the Business Management Manager, this role analyzes Toyota and Lexus dealer financial statements within the United States.  The ideal candidate will have a strong accounting/finance background with a firm understanding of the balance sheet and income statement and the ability to determine how business changes impact profitability. 

What you’ll be doing  

Perform monthly analysis of individual and composite Toyota and Lexus dealership financial statements to assess dealers' financial health and determine appropriate comparisons for composite groups. 

  • Analyze financial trends, interpret their implications, and effectively communicate these insights to audiences with varying levels of financial statement comprehension. 

  • Prepare and distribute Toyota and Lexus Departmental Summaries, Business Management Reports and other monthly reporting.  

  • Conduct ad hoc analyses as requested for senior management, Regions, Areas, and other TMNA departments.

  • Collaborate with Toyota Regional and Lexus Area personnel concerning Toyota/Lexus accounting procedures to assist their dealers in preparing and submitting precise and consistent financial statements. 

  • Supervise the Toyota Controllers Excellence Award program. 

  • Support the annual financial statement conversion process for both Toyota and Lexus. This includes creating templates, testing, and validating new statements and reports. 

  • Collaborate with Dealer Information Support and IT to improve reports, systems, and technologies. 

  • Understand, monitor and analyze all RMD capital and operating financial standards to ensure they are applicable with current market conditions and acceptable risk standards. 

  • Assess new programs and products and set parameters for the financial statement error system to identify misreporting by dealers and risks associated with the new programs and products.  

  • Facilitate the annual class size assignments for Toyota and Lexus Dealers.
